Project Progress and matters arising

  • It was agreed that the clock would be restored and a solar panel mechanism would now to be used.
  • The demolition of the boiler room awaited the removal of the gas pipe. BRE sealed off the gas main upon exposure. This has now been completed and demolition has commenced.
  • Work on existing and new underground service ducts are now 90% complete.
  • The initiative to involve local children with the live/work unit design is progressing quickly.
  • The acoustic performance possibilities for the workshop area will be examined. The current layout will be provided by the Facilities Management team to confirm what is currently included and a ?short? report will be issued explaining the opportunities to improve the sound levels.
